scope:
This Standard applies to cord-connected room air conditioners rated not more than 250 volts, single phase, with a rated capacity not over 36,000 Btu/hr, designed to be used in accordance with the Rules of Canadian Electrical Code, Part I.
This Standard applies to self-contained air-cooled window, or console or built-in-wall type room air conditioners, which have hermetic-type condensing units and which are intended to be installed in the conditioned room, usually in or in front of a window, or in a wall or transom.
